I am unable to intall the flac converter. The installation gives the
error message: "Error whilst running <PATH>\MusicConverter.exe".
This happens during the installation itself, so I never get to the point
of actually trying to run the program.
I know this has been addressed before, but they seemed to be trying
to install multiple products, and I am just trying to install the converter.
Any help on this?
LtData
06-14-2005, 06:54 PM
Have you already installed dBpowerAmp Music Converter itself? Did you install this codec to the same directory?
